Transaction 154f50fce5e411a84efdc25705f052480f18586d3c045d04713a03cb47d8ec21

1 Input
2 Outputs
  • 154f50fce5e411a84efdc25705f052480f18586d3c045d04713a03cb47d8ec21:0
  • value  743720581
    address  3JWTzkcD5RaUUu3pWEEzpmWAk41aWv4wCD
  • 154f50fce5e411a84efdc25705f052480f18586d3c045d04713a03cb47d8ec21:1
  • value  7915975961
    address  1J4c3etsVLd8C8Ad36vMkk9Ra1TmCMbCHV